The Reality Check
Here is the trade-off. You don’t get the UK Financial Ombudsman or the UKGC as a backstop. If something goes wrong, you are dealing with a foreign regulator. That changes the equation.
| Feature | UKGC Casino | Non GamStop Casino |
|---|---|---|
| Regulatory Safety Net | Strong (UK Ombudsman) | Varies by License (Malta, Curacao, etc.) |
| Payment Speed | Slow (1-5 days+) | Fast (Instant to 24 hours) |
| Bonus Flexibility | Restricted | High (but read the terms) |
| Player Responsibility | Low (Regulator mandates tools) | High (You must choose to use them) |
That last row is the most important. International casinos offer responsible gambling tools-deposit limits, session reminders, self-exclusion. But the UKGC doesn’t force them to shove it in your face. The responsibility shifts to you.
How to Evaluate a Non GamStop Casino
Don’t just look at the game library. Look at the license. Look at the withdrawal terms. Here is a quick checklist that filters out the junk operators.
- Verify the License. Curacao eGaming is common. Malta (MGA) is stronger. If you can’t find a license number, walk away.
- Read the Bonus Terms. Specifically the wagering requirements and max cashout. A 40x rollover is standard. Anything above 50x is a red flag.
- Check the Withdrawal Limits. Some casinos cap withdrawals at $100 per week. That is a waste of time. Look for high or unlimited limits.
- Test the Customer Support. Send a message. See if they respond in 24 hours. If they don’t, don’t deposit.
These four steps will save you more headaches than any review site.
